Takayasu arteritis

 

 

The intima is thickened and fibrotic. There is a focus of necrosis in the media with an inflammatory

deposit. Three arteritides; syphilitic, giant cell, and Takayasu are sometimes difficult to

differentiate histologically. All three can show necrosis, giant cells, and perivascular cuffing.
